Why buy the HP Omen 16L?
The HP Omen 16L has quite a few valuable hardware components for a mid-range gaming PC. It comes packed with an NVIDIA GeForce RTX 5060 Ti GPU, an Intel Core Ultra 7 265F processor, 16GB of RAM (DDR5-5600), and a 1 TB SSD.
The RTX 5060 Ti is widely praised by critics, with reviews like Tom's Hardware stating that it offers great performance thanks to its Blackwell tech with GDDR7 support, granting it high transfer speeds along with a large L2 cache to help improve its bandwidth.
When the RTX 5060 Ti is used in conjunction with the HP Omen 16L's other specs, it will be able to run most PC games at 1080p or even 1440p resolutions at 60fps smoothly with little issue. Plus, the 1TB SSD will allow faster read speeds and tons more storage space to fit in your favorite games.
What's even better about the HP Omen 16L is its value. With an MSRP of $1479.99, this gaming PC is actually cheaper buying most of the components needed to build yourself.
I verified this with PCPartPicker and found out that the CPU, GPU, Windows 11 OS, RAM, and SSD alone cost $1572.95, and that's without taking built-in Wi-Fi, Motherboard, or Power Supply.

FAQ
Is its power supply sufficient?
The HP Omen 16L is equipped with a 500W power supply. While it's considered enough to handle its stock configuration, it may struggle to provide power for energy-hungry GPUs with greater hardware specs than the RTX 4060 Ti.
Does its 16L casing cause overheating?
The HP Omen 16L's compact design can lead to it overheating (with temperatures going as high as 90°C or even 100°C) as it leaves little room for its fans to circulate air while in operation or performing demanding tasks.
Thankfully, the HP Omen 16L's system are designed to trigger thermal throttling by reducing its clock speeds when it gets too hot in order to protect its internal hardware from being damaged by the heat.
